Industries which use titration includes Water waste analysis industry, Food Industry, Suger Industry, Wine Industry, Pharmaceutical Industry etc.
Titration is a technique used in chemistry to measure the proportions of chemicals in a solution.
Titration is an analytical technique that is widely used in the food industry. It allows food manufacturers to determine the quantity of a reactant in a sample. For example, it can be used to discover the amount of salt or sugar in a product or the concentration of vitamin C or E, which has an effect on product colour.
